What Is Mobile Application Design?

Mobile application design is a structured process that involves planning, designing, developing, testing, and launching software for smartphones and tablets. The primary goal is to create a functional, user-friendly application that meets both business objectives and user expectations.

Stages of Mobile Application Design

1. Defining Goals and Requirements

The first step is identifying the application's purpose and understanding user needs. Clearly defining project goals helps ensure the app delivers real value and solves the intended problems.

2. Research and Competitor Analysis

Analyzing similar applications and evaluating competitors' strengths and weaknesses provides valuable insights into market trends and opportunities for differentiation.

3. Wireframing and Information Architecture

Wireframes outline the application's structure, user flow, and navigation before visual design begins. This stage helps organize content and improve usability.

4. User Interface (UI) Design

UI design focuses on the visual appearance of the application, including layouts, colors, typography, icons, and interactive elements that create an engaging user experience.

5. Development and Programming

During development, the application's functionality is implemented using native or cross-platform technologies. Features, integrations, and business logic are built and optimized for performance.

6. Testing and Quality Assurance

Comprehensive testing is conducted to identify and resolve bugs, improve performance, ensure security, and verify compatibility across different devices and operating systems.

7. Deployment and Marketing

Once testing is complete, the application is published on app stores such as Google Play and the Apple App Store. Marketing strategies are then implemented to attract users and maximize downloads.
